View Java Class Source Code in JAR file
- Download JD-GUI to open JAR file and explore Java source code file (.class .java)
- Click menu "File → Open File..." or just drag-and-drop the JAR file in the JD-GUI window datalink-0.0.2.jar file.
Once you open a JAR file, all the java classes in the JAR file will be displayed.
cn.guruguru.datalink.protocol.enums
├─ cn.guruguru.datalink.protocol.enums.DataFormat.class - [JAR]
├─ cn.guruguru.datalink.protocol.enums.KafkaScanStartupMode.class - [JAR]
├─ cn.guruguru.datalink.protocol.enums.MetaKey.class - [JAR]
├─ cn.guruguru.datalink.protocol.enums.RuntimeMode.class - [JAR]
├─ cn.guruguru.datalink.protocol.enums.WriteMode.class - [JAR]
cn.guruguru.datalink.ddl.converter
├─ cn.guruguru.datalink.ddl.converter.DdlConverter.class - [JAR]
├─ cn.guruguru.datalink.ddl.converter.FlinkDdlConverter.class - [JAR]
├─ cn.guruguru.datalink.ddl.converter.SparkDdlConverter.class - [JAR]
cn.guruguru.datalink.protocol.node.extract.cdc
├─ cn.guruguru.datalink.protocol.node.extract.cdc.AbstractCdcN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.cdc.KafkaCdcN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.cdc.KafkaN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.cdc.MongoCdcN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.cdc.MysqlCdcN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.cdc.OracleCdcNode.class - [JAR]
cn.guruguru.datalink.parser.factory
├─ cn.guruguru.datalink.parser.factory.FlinkSqlParserFactory.class - [JAR]
├─ cn.guruguru.datalink.parser.factory.ParserFactory.class - [JAR]
├─ cn.guruguru.datalink.parser.factory.SimpleParserFactory.class - [JAR]
├─ cn.guruguru.datalink.parser.factory.SparkSqlParserFactory.class - [JAR]
cn.guruguru.datalink.ddl.statement
├─ cn.guruguru.datalink.ddl.statement.CreateDatabaseStatement.class - [JAR]
├─ cn.guruguru.datalink.ddl.statement.CreateTableStatement.class - [JAR]
cn.guruguru.datalink.exception
├─ cn.guruguru.datalink.exception.IllegalDDLException.class - [JAR]
├─ cn.guruguru.datalink.exception.SQLSyntaxException.class - [JAR]
├─ cn.guruguru.datalink.exception.UnsupportedDataSourceException.class - [JAR]
├─ cn.guruguru.datalink.exception.UnsupportedDataTypeException.class - [JAR]
├─ cn.guruguru.datalink.exception.UnsupportedEngineException.class - [JAR]
cn.guruguru.datalink.type.definition
├─ cn.guruguru.datalink.type.definition.FlinkDataTypes.class - [JAR]
├─ cn.guruguru.datalink.type.definition.SparkDataTypes.class - [JAR]
cn.guruguru.datalink.parser
├─ cn.guruguru.datalink.parser.Parser.class - [JAR]
cn.guruguru.datalink.protocol.field
├─ cn.guruguru.datalink.protocol.field.ConstantField.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.DataField.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.DataType.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.Field.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.MetaField.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.StringConstantField.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.TimeUnitConstantField.class - [JAR]
├─ cn.guruguru.datalink.protocol.field.WatermarkField.class - [JAR]
cn.guruguru.datalink.protocol.node.transform
├─ cn.guruguru.datalink.protocol.node.transform.TransformNode.class - [JAR]
cn.guruguru.datalink.parser.impl
├─ cn.guruguru.datalink.parser.impl.AbstractSqlParser.class - [JAR]
├─ cn.guruguru.datalink.parser.impl.FlinkSqlParser.class - [JAR]
├─ cn.guruguru.datalink.parser.impl.SparkSqlParser.class - [JAR]
cn.guruguru.datalink.ddl.table
├─ cn.guruguru.datalink.ddl.table.Affix.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.AffixStrategy.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.CaseStrategy.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.JdbcDialect.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.TableDuplicateStrategy.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.TableField.class - [JAR]
├─ cn.guruguru.datalink.ddl.table.TableSchema.class - [JAR]
cn.guruguru.datalink.protocol
├─ cn.guruguru.datalink.protocol.LinkInfo.class - [JAR]
├─ cn.guruguru.datalink.protocol.Metadata.class - [JAR]
cn.guruguru.datalink.protocol.relation
├─ cn.guruguru.datalink.protocol.relation.FieldRelation.class - [JAR]
├─ cn.guruguru.datalink.protocol.relation.NodeLocation.class - [JAR]
├─ cn.guruguru.datalink.protocol.relation.NodeRelation.class - [JAR]
├─ cn.guruguru.datalink.protocol.relation.Relation.class - [JAR]
cn.guruguru.datalink.protocol.node.extract
├─ cn.guruguru.datalink.protocol.node.extract.CdcExtractN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.ScanExtractNode.class - [JAR]
cn.guruguru.datalink.parser.result
├─ cn.guruguru.datalink.parser.result.FlinkSqlParseResult.class - [JAR]
├─ cn.guruguru.datalink.parser.result.ParseResult.class - [JAR]
├─ cn.guruguru.datalink.parser.result.SparkSqlParseResult.class - [JAR]
cn.guruguru.datalink.type.converter
├─ cn.guruguru.datalink.type.converter.DataTypeConverter.class - [JAR]
├─ cn.guruguru.datalink.type.converter.FlinkDataTypeConverter.class - [JAR]
├─ cn.guruguru.datalink.type.converter.SparkDataTypeConverter.class - [JAR]
cn.guruguru.datalink.protocol.node
├─ cn.guruguru.datalink.protocol.node.ExtractN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.LoadN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.Node.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.NodeDeserializer.class - [JAR]
cn.guruguru.datalink.datasource
├─ cn.guruguru.datalink.datasource.DataSourceType.class - [JAR]
├─ cn.guruguru.datalink.datasource.NodeDataSource.class - [JAR]
cn.guruguru.datalink.protocol.node.load
├─ cn.guruguru.datalink.protocol.node.load.LakehouseLoadNode.class - [JAR]
cn.guruguru.datalink.protocol.node.extract.scan
├─ cn.guruguru.datalink.protocol.node.extract.scan.DmScanN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.scan.GreenplumScanN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.scan.JdbcScanN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.scan.MySqlScanN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.scan.OracleScanNode.class - [JAR]
├─ cn.guruguru.datalink.protocol.node.extract.scan.PostgresqlScanNode.class - [JAR]
cn.guruguru.datalink.ddl.result
├─ cn.guruguru.datalink.ddl.result.DdlConverterResult.class - [JAR]
├─ cn.guruguru.datalink.ddl.result.FlinkDdlConverterResult.class - [JAR]
├─ cn.guruguru.datalink.ddl.result.SparkDdlConverterResult.class - [JAR]
cn.guruguru.datalink.utils
├─ cn.guruguru.datalink.utils.JdbcUrlUtil.class - [JAR]
├─ cn.guruguru.datalink.utils.NodeUtil.class - [JAR]
├─ cn.guruguru.datalink.utils.SqlUtil.class - [JAR]
cn.guruguru.datalink.type.converter.factory
├─ cn.guruguru.datalink.type.converter.factory.SimpleTypeConverterFactory.class - [JAR]